Welcome to the LC Lamar Bruni Vergara Environmental Science Center

Come walk on the wild side at the Laredo College Lamar Bruni Vergara Environmental Science Center, where you can experience all that surrounds you.  The center contains representations of the Rio Grande ecosystem and live specimens of plant and animal life to serve as a living science laboratory for local students.

The center supports college-level study in various disciplines, including all sciences, the visual arts, languages, mathematics, kinesiology and speech/drama, among others. 

PK-12 curriculum also has been developed to integrate the center’s laboratory experience into classroom study by children in local public and private schools.  The center is a regional destination for elementary, middle and high school students to receive experiential science instruction, mainly in life, biological, aquatic and environmental sciences.
